首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

curl:(56)在GCP SDK中出现故障,但在VM中不出现故障

Curl是一个功能强大的开源命令行工具,用于与服务器进行数据交互。它支持多种协议,包括HTTP、HTTPS、FTP、SFTP等,并提供了丰富的功能和参数,可以完成各种网络请求和操作。

当在GCP SDK中出现故障,但在VM中不出现故障时,可能是由于以下原因导致的:

  1. 网络连接问题:GCP SDK与GCP服务之间的网络连接可能受到限制或存在故障,导致无法正常进行通信。这可能涉及网络配置、防火墙规则、路由问题等。在VM中不出现故障可能是由于VM所在的网络环境与GCP SDK连接没有问题。
  2. 认证和权限问题:GCP SDK需要有效的认证凭据才能与GCP服务进行通信。如果SDK的认证配置有误或缺失,可能会导致故障。另外,访问GCP服务的权限设置也可能影响SDK的正常运行。

对于这个问题,你可以尝试以下步骤来解决:

  1. 检查网络连接:确保GCP SDK所在的网络环境能够与GCP服务正常通信。可以检查网络配置、防火墙规则、路由设置等,并确保它们与VM中的配置一致。
  2. 检查认证配置:确保GCP SDK的认证配置正确,并且具有足够的权限来访问所需的GCP服务。可以使用GCP身份验证工具(如gcloud命令)来检查和管理认证配置。
  3. 更新SDK版本:如果你正在使用的GCP SDK版本较旧,尝试升级到最新版本,以获得更好的兼容性和bug修复。
  4. 联系支持:如果上述步骤无法解决问题,可以联系GCP的技术支持团队,向他们提供详细的错误信息和环境配置,以便他们能够帮助你进一步诊断和解决问题。

腾讯云的相关产品和服务可以提供类似功能和解决方案,你可以参考腾讯云提供的云计算服务文档来了解更多相关信息。以下是腾讯云提供的与网络通信相关的产品和文档链接:

  1. 云服务器(CVM):https://cloud.tencent.com/product/cvm
  2. 云虚拟主机(CVH):https://cloud.tencent.com/product/cvh
  3. 云负载均衡(CLB):https://cloud.tencent.com/product/clb
  4. 云原生容器实例(TCI):https://cloud.tencent.com/product/tci
  5. 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ke

请注意,以上链接只是腾讯云提供的一些示例产品和文档,实际使用时还需要根据具体需求选择合适的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

故障创建与编排更胜一筹的K8S混沌工程开源平台Litmus

创建者 MayaData 一句话介绍 LitmusChaos 是一个故障创建与编排方面更胜一筹的K8S混沌工程开源平台,如提供故障注入实验库 ChaosHub,使团队能够以受控方式,引入故障注入实验来识别基础设施的弱点和潜在停机隐患...亚马逊云系统管理服务SSM实验,包括aws-ssm-chaos-by-id、aws-ssm-chaos-by-tag、 谷歌云gcp实验,包括gcp-vm-instance-stop、gcp-vm-disk-loss...、gcp-vm-instance-stop-by-label、gcp-vm-disk-loss-by-label。...Litmus探针 可以 ChaosEngine 为任何故障注入实验定义可插入的Litmus 探针,使得实验容器可以根据定义的模式,执行相关检查,以确定实验结论。...适用平台 K8S 适用场景 对于开发人员:应用程序开发过程运行故障注入实验,作为单元测试或集成测试的扩展。

24410

故障创建与编排更胜一筹的K8S混沌工程开源平台Litmus

图片创建者MayaData一句话介绍LitmusChaos 是一个故障创建与编排方面更胜一筹的K8S混沌工程开源平台,如提供故障注入实验库 ChaosHub,使团队能够以受控方式,引入故障注入实验来识别基础设施的弱点和潜在停机隐患...7类故障注入实验类型ChaosHub的49个故障注入实验,可以分为7类:通用、亚马逊云kube-aws、亚马逊云系统管理服务SSM、谷歌云gcp、微软云azure、VMware和SpringBoot。...谷歌云gcp实验,包括gcp-vm-instance-stop、gcp-vm-disk-loss、gcp-vm-instance-stop-by-label、gcp-vm-disk-loss-by-label...Litmus探针可以 ChaosEngine 为任何故障注入实验定义可插入的Litmus 探针,使得实验容器可以根据定义的模式,执行相关检查,以确定实验结论。...适用平台K8S适用场景对于开发人员:应用程序开发过程运行故障注入实验,作为单元测试或集成测试的扩展。

44370

cURL无法访问TLS网站故障解决

cURL出现故障的时候,直接就导致很多开发工具的升级或者安装依赖包无法继续。...今天碰到一个故障,一台有些年头的服务器升级一个安全组件的时候报了一个错误: cURL error 35: error:14077410:SSL routines:SSL23_GET_SERVER_HELLO...EXPORT56:!aNULL:!LOW:!...openssl源码的选择上是个小坑。如果是一台新的服务器,当然会希望使用最新的版本,很少会有什么兼容性问题。 但在一台老的服务器上,操作系统版本也比较低,使用最新的版本就不一定好了。...然后可以继续下面编译cURL,否则编译完白费时间,仍然不能用。 cURL通常使用最新版就可以,极少碰到兼容的情况。仍然工作电脑下载,完成后scp拷贝到目标服务器,过程略。

3.8K30

《.NET 5.0 背锅案》第1集:验证 .NET 5.0 正式版 docker 镜像问题

今天我们分析了博客站点的2次故障故障一、故障二),发现一个巧合的地方,.NET 5.0 正式版的 docker 镜像是11月10日提前发布上线的。...所以这2次故障时用的都是基于 .NET 5.0 正式版的镜像,而且11月10日至11月12日期间,我们只进行了2次发布,2次都出现故障。...如果片面地从这个巧合来看,似乎故障与 .NET 5.0 正式版镜像有关,这时你可能立马提出疑问,同样是基于 .NET 5.0 正式版的镜像,为什么今天早上发布没有出现故障?....NET 5.0 没有出现过这个问题,所以今天早上发布正常很可能是因为没有到达触发故障的并发量。...另外,今天早上发布时我们已经将博客项目依赖的下面这些 nuget 包升级到 .NET 5.0 正式版对应的版本,昨天晚上处理故障时也进行过这个升级发布尝试,但没有解决问题,与故障关联的可能性很小,但从中可以得到的信息是故障时项目代码是基于

43330

ARTS-15-DevOps是什么和SRE必知清单

Review:主要是为了学习英文 Tip:主要是为了总结和归纳日常工作中所遇到的知识点。学习至少一个技术技巧。在工作遇到的问题,踩过的坑,学习的点滴知识。...DevOps的出现是为了带来一种新的软件开发文化,以降低开发与运维之间的鸿沟 然而,DevOps的本质并不是教导大家怎么做才会成功,而是订定一些基本原则让大家各自发挥,用程序设计的术语来说,DevOps...(swapon -s,/proc/sys/vm/swappiness,sysctl vm.swappiness ..) 8)掌握一门脚本语言,如Python,Perl 9)掌握有用的命令,如进程监控命令...,了解A、AAAA、CNAME、TXT的区别,理解递归和权威DNS的区别,学会排查DNS问题(nslookup,dig ..etc) 18)理解当你浏览器输入www.liangsonghua.me然后回车会发生什么...将这些工具与其他工具(如构建工具,配置管理软件,Docker,云提供商的SDK ..等)集成 49)学习分布式版本控制系统Git及其基本命令(pull,push,commit,clone,branch,

85640

【可用性设计】 GCP 面向规模和高可用性的设计

创建冗余以提高可用性 具有高可靠性需求的系统必须没有单点故障,并且它们的资源必须跨多个故障域进行复制。故障域是可以独立发生故障的资源池,例如 VM 实例、专区或区域。...区域出现故障时使用跨区域的数据复制和自动故障转移。一些 Google Cloud 服务具有多区域变体,例如 BigQuery 和 Cloud Spanner。...以保留功能的方式进行故障保护 如果由于问题而出现故障,则系统组件应以允许整个系统继续运行的方式发生故障。这些问题可能是软件错误、错误的输入或配置、计划外的实例中断或人为错误。...负载下测试服务启动,并相应地提供启动依赖项。考虑通过保存从关键启动依赖项检索到的数据的副本来优雅降级的设计。此行为允许您的服务使用可能过时的数据重新启动,而不是关键依赖项出现中断时无法启动。...如果最新版本出现问题,这种设计方法可以让您安全地回滚。 建议 要将架构框架的指南应用于您自己的环境,请遵循以下建议: 客户端应用程序的错误重试逻辑中使用随机化实现指数退避。

1.2K20

故障发现、定位提效超70%,去哪儿可观测体系做了哪些优化?

由于VM单一指标的查询上表现优秀,我们决定让VM专注于单一指标的查询,而复杂指标查询和聚合则交由CarbonAPI处理。...在这次改造,我们将任务调度的功能转移到了Worker节点上,尽管这使得Worker变成了有状态的服务,但是如果一个Worker出现故障,Master会监听到这个变化并将该Worker的任务重新分配给其他节点...解决方案: 为了解决这个问题,我们对监控的SDK进行了改造和Qtracer进行联动。每次请求进入时,QTracer会检查当前链路是否有传入的TraceID。如果有,则生成Span对象。...首先,我们认为预案系统的重要性在于,大部分的告警和故障都伴随着异常指标出现。然而,有些告警的阈值设定过于敏感,即使是核心告警,有时仅仅触发告警的情况下,也未必达到故障级别。...我们的目标是一分钟内发现这类故障。此外,我们的秒级监控也适用于其他一些场景,比如秒杀活动。 最后,我们的预案系统主要是复杂的系统环境和依赖关系,帮助我们定位故障

45910

Sysdig:Linux系统监控与分析的全能利器

Linux系统的运维工作,监控和分析是保证系统稳定性和性能的关键环节。传统的监控工具如strace、tcpdump等各有所长,但往往只关注系统的某一方面,而且使用起来相对独立,缺乏统一的视角。...自定义输出,字段前必须加上 % 前缀,所有 sysdig -l 列出的字段都可使用。你可以字符串中加入其他可读性内容,它们会被直接打印出来。...如果某个字段事件不存在,那么默认该事件会被过滤掉。...例如,以下命令可以列出所有容器的网络连接情况: sysdig -pc container.name= 故障排查 系统出现故障时,Sysdig的事件记录功能可以帮助...例如,以下命令可以将系统活动记录到文件,供后续分析: sysdig -w trace.scap.gz Sysdig作为一款全面且强大的系统监控工具,它的出现极大地简化了系统管理和故障排查的工作

69311

「分布式计算」什么是严格一致性和最终一致性?

分布式系统,假设单个节点会失效。系统必须对节点故障具有弹性。因此,为了冗余,数据必须跨多个节点进行复制。...为什么企业存储需要严格的一致性 企业存储,存在最终一致性是正确模型的情况,例如跨站点复制的例子。但在绝大多数情况下,严格的一致性是必需的。让我们看几个需要严格一致性的例子。...一个企业客户曾经向我解释说,负载过重的情况下,一个节点可能会被标记为脱机。实际上,它是关闭的,导致客户端几秒钟前成功编写的文件出现“文件未找到”错误。这对它们的应用程序造成了严重破坏。...由于严格的一致性,即使基础设施出现故障,也能保证应用程序可用性/正常运行时间和没有数据丢失。 设计备份环境时,应当首先考虑向外扩展文件存储和从备份中立即恢复的这些事项。...VMvSphere上被实例化和访问。读和写I/O被定向到存储单个节点的存储抽象(NFS)上的VM。 此时正在创建的新数据不受保护。它不分布在数据保护和恢复集群的其他节点上。

1.2K20

exsi速用命令和常见问题

>被锁定,无法访问” 故障内容:环境的所有VM运行出现异常缓慢,关机后的虚拟机开机或VMotion出现“文件被锁定,无法访问” 解决方法:检查日志,特别是存储上...故障现象:客户的X86 Windows2003VM系统使用中会不定时的关机。...3.VC,把被锁的VM从Inventoryremove掉。原因很简单,这是一个 unregister的过程。...52、尝试迁移一台带USB设备的VM失败 故障状态: 执行虚拟机迁移向导时,如果系统检测到兼容的USB设备存在,则系统会提示如下错误信息: Currently connecteddevice ‘USB...完成后开启虚拟机就可以了 60、view桌面,Win7下安装出现软件出现“系统管理员设置了系统策略,禁止进行此安装”的提示 解决方案: 1、打开“开始->控制面板->管理工具->本地安全策略”->点击

9.4K20

Traffic Director如何为开放服务网格提供全局负载均衡

Traffic Director开箱即用,可以用于VM和容器。它使用开源 xDS API 与数据平面的服务代理进行通信,确保不会被锁定在专有接口中。...Traffic Director为服务网格的内部微服务带来全局负载均衡。借助全局负载均衡,您可以全世界的Google Cloud Platform(GCP)区域中配置服务实例。...这些包括重定向,重写,header转换,镜像,故障注入等。每服务流量策略:这些策略指定负载均衡算法,熔断器参数和其他以服务为中心的配置。...使用Traffic Director,可以使用 托管实例组 和容器端点将VM端点配置为 独立网络端点组。如上所述,像 Envoy 这样的开源服务代理被注入到每一个实例。...容器和VM的其余数据模型和策略保持不变,如下所示:此模型服务部署时提供一致性,并且能够提供无缝地全局负载均衡,跨越服务的VM实例和容器实例。

98810

使用HyperForm自动配置虚拟机(第1部分)

监控预配置的虚拟机(CPU,内存,磁盘利用率),并在VM发生故障或性能指标超出预定义阈值时收取通知/警报。 管理整个企业的多个租户。...自动生成的脚本可供用户Hyper-V服务器上安装代理。您可以通过将“some-password”重写为您自定义的密码来更改脚本的密码。 密码:这是代理使用的密码。...一旦将计算机配置到集群,用户就不能更改网络设置。这里是可用的网络: Docker:允许多个容器同一个主机上相互连接。 编织:允许多个容器从多个主机相互连接。...跳过Docker安装:推荐用于具有非容器工作负载的VM配置(例如,预先安装在VM模板的软件)。 租约:用户可以指定此集群的服务器何时到期,以便HyperForm可以自动销毁这些服务器。...(即该新服务器将被分配到所填写的集群中去,译者注) [hyper-v-already-running-vm_orig.png] 一旦用户点击保存,就会出现一个自动生成的脚本。

2.1K60

Google全球服务宕机50分钟!

Google太平洋标准时间(PST)14日凌晨3:45发生全球服务中断事件,其是因其自动化配额管理系统降低了Google内部的全球单一身分管理系统的容量,使得需要用户登入的服务全都出现故障,影响包括Google...云平台(GCP)与Google Workspace ,一直到PST时间4:35才恢复正常,整整停摆了50分钟,不过,此事件并未波及Google搜寻。...此次中断的Google服务除了该公司所列出的隶属于GCP服务的Cloud Console、Cloud Storage、BigQuery、Google Kubernetes Engine服务,以及属于Google...Workspace的Gmail、Calendar、Docs、Drive、Meet服务之外,由于出问题的是Google的身分管理系统,因此一般用户的各种服务也同样出现错误信息,包括YouTube、Blogger...根据Downdector的统计,Google Maps出现问题的用户,有52%表示无法使用;Gmail有问题的使用者,有79%无法登入。

64020

从脆弱到完美:Kubernetes自我修复实践

即使是公有云也会偶尔出现故障。硬件故障、内核错误配置、网络瓶颈、有问题的推出、资源稀缺、安全漏洞等会导致持续数分钟或在某些情况下持续数周的复杂情况。...例如,我们将所有节点故障信号整合到一个“节点检查器”仪表板,使我们的开发人员能够收到寻呼时迅速做出响应。...以下部分,我们将详细描述一些 Automation ,涵盖如何识别每种故障模式以及如何对其自愈进行 Automation 。...我们观察到 VMSS 层VM 故障通常会使 AKS 节点不可访问。发生这种情况时,节点控制器会添加一个 NoExecute 污点,并且节点上的所有 Pod 都会在 5 分钟后被驱逐。...Kubernetes 依赖于主机 VM 上的 nftables,用于节点上进行 Pod 间路由规则和出口流量。这阻止了网络策略正确应用,导致节点上出现不规则的网络故障

11610

SRE Production Rediness Review 指南(From GitLab.com)

(可选)如果后来决定继续执行此提案,请添加工作流程基础设施取消并关闭这个问题 “审阅者”部分选中所有框后,添加工作流程基础设施完毕标记并关闭问题。...对于每个组件和依赖项,故障的爆炸半径是多少?功能设计中有什么可以降低这种风险的吗? 如果适用,请解释此新功能将如何扩展以及设计任何潜在的单点故障。...有哪些操作问题不会在发布时出现,但可能会在以后出现? 新产品功能上线后是否可以安全回滚,是否可以使用功能标志将其禁用? 记录客户与此新功能交互的每一种方式,以及每次交互失败对客户的影响。...网络安全(加密和端口在上面的架构图中要清楚) 防火墙遵循最小特权原则(使用 Kubernetes 的网络策略或云提供商的防火墙) 该服务是否包含在任何 DDoS 保护解决方案GCP/AWS 负载均衡器或...简要概述一下 GitLab 的 CI/CD 管道针对此功能自动运行哪些测试?

1.1K40

ETH Dapp 体验报告

对比现代web应用程序依赖的基础设施,其中存在单点故障的问题。这些单点故障包括服务器基础设施、代码库、数据库等。...随着高可用性和可靠的基础设施服务商(GCP和AWS等)出现,减轻单点故障方面取得进展,但强如亚马逊,也会出现2018年初的停运,很难避免停机。...Dapp通过多个对等节点网络上存储数据或基础架构的关键组件来缓解这些问题。如果网络的每个参与者都拥有数据副本,则数据很难丢失。...“软件,业务逻辑是程序的一部分,它编码确定如何创建、存储和更改数据的现实业务规则。”业务逻辑本质上是一组合约,规定业务对象如相互交互、并定义用户或其他对象如何访问和更新对象。...传统的web应用程序,这些业务逻辑合约是可变的软件实现。软件初始创建后可以进行修改,同时也不能保证防篡改和可审计的私有服务器上运行。

94620

K8S故障注入混沌工程开源平台ChaosMesh

可以用它方便地模拟开发、测试、生产环境可能出现的各种异常情况,发现系统潜在的问题。...关键特性 ChaosMesh的关键特性包括可注入的故障、实验工作流、可视化操作和安全控制。 可注入的故障 可注入的故障,包括基本资源故障,平台故障和应用故障这3类。...基本资源故障,包括模拟Pod失效,网络失效,DNS失效,HTTP通信延迟,CPU或内存使用高负荷,文件读写失效,时间跳跃异常,应用内存分配异常等。 平台故障,包括模拟AWS或GCP节点重启。...可视化操作 可视化操作,包括可以Web UI上点击鼠标,定义实验的范围、故障注入类型和调度规则,最后能展示实验结果。...可以 Web UI 上轻松设计 Chaos 场景并监控 Chaos 实验的状态。 使用K8S原生提供的基于角色的访问控制功能,来管理故障注入的使用权限。 劣势 只能在K8S集群上使用。

30530
领券